FROM HERE TO ETERNITY
“May he click into eternity,” said David Bowie of Masayoshi Sukita, a Japanese photographer who shared a 40-year friendship with the late music icon, while documenting London’s punk era and the 1970s American rock scene. Presenting the best of his five-decade-long oeuvre, Eternity is a 256-page labour of love that spans the 83-year-old lensman’s fashion photography, celebrity portraits and lesser-known travel visuals—providing insights into why Iggy Pop has declared Sukita the photographer he trusts the most.
